Fermented milk is a type of dairy product with a unique flavor and beneficial probiotic content. It can be made in a variety of ways and is enjoyed around the world. Making fermented milk at home is not complicated, but it does require some patience.

The process of making fermented milk involves lactic acid fermentation, which transforms the milk’s sugars into lactic acid. This process creates an acidic environment that makes it difficult for harmful bacteria to survive, while beneficial bacteria thrive and ferment the milk. As the bacteria break down the lactose in the milk, other compounds are created that give fermented milk its characteristic flavor and texture.Fermented milk, also known as cultured milk, is a dairy product made by fermenting regular milk with beneficial bacteria. Common bacteria used for fermentation are lactic acid bacteria such as Lactobacillus bulgaricus and Streptococcus thermophilus. The fermentation process gives the milk a slightly sour taste and a thicker texture compared to regular milk.

Fermented Milk

Fermented milk is a type of dairy product made by fermenting milk with a bacterial culture. This process gives the milk a tangy taste and thicker consistency, which can be used as an ingredient in many dishes. The fermentation also helps to preserve the milk for longer periods of time. The most commonly used bacteria for fermentation are lactic acid bacteria, which convert the lactose present in the milk into lactic acid. This acid then helps to thicken the milk and give it its distinctive flavor.

The process of making fermented milk is relatively simple, but it does require some specialized equipment. First, the fresh milk is heated to about 85°C for 10-15 minutes to pasteurize it, killing any bacteria that may be present in the milk and ensuring that only the desired bacteria will be used for fermentation. The milk is then cooled down and mixed with a starter culture containing lactic acid bacteria. This culture will help to initiate the fermentation process and give the finished product its distinctive flavor.

The mixture is then placed in an airtight container and left at room temperature for 12-18 hours while it ferments. During this time, the lactic acid bacteria convert the lactose in the milk into lactic acid, which thickens it and gives it its tangy flavor. Once this process is complete, the fermented milk can be consumed as-is or used as an ingredient in various dishes such as yogurt or cheese.

The Process of Fermenting Milk

Fermenting milk is a process that has been used for centuries to create a variety of dairy products. This process involves adding bacteria or yeast to milk, which breaks down the milk’s sugars into lactic acid. The lactic acid gives the milk a tangy flavor and makes it easier to digest. The fermentation process also increases the shelf-life of the milk, allowing it to be stored for longer periods of time.

The first step in fermenting milk is to select the type of bacteria or yeast used. Commonly used strains include Lactobacillus and Streptococcus thermophilus. Once the bacteria or yeast has been selected, it needs to be added to warm milk and left at room temperature for several hours or overnight. During this time, the bacteria will convert lactose (the sugar found in milk) into lactic acid, which gives fermented milk its distinct flavor and increases its shelf life.
